Shanghai Chemstar Logistics Co., Ltd.

Address: Room 2704, No.750 South Tibet road, 200011, Shanghai, China
Tel: +86.21.6346.0151/ +86.21.6346.0152 / +86.21.6346.0153
Fax: +86.21.5168.6210
Email: [email protected]
Website: http://www.chemstarlogistics.com/

Add a Comment

Your email address will not be published. Required fields are marked *